Latest Patents

Among her latest innovations, Yuki has developed a pioneering power conversion device featuring advanced power conversion circuitry designed to efficiently convert DC power into AC power. This device incorporates a complex system of switching parameters that enhance the performance of electrical loads. Another significant patent is focused on a power conversion device that utilizes a control amount calculation unit, which calculates multiple control amounts reflective of the driving conditions of a rotary electric machine. This technology ingeniously generates command values that ensure operational efficiency, adapting to varying conditions of the machine.
